I have a 'before' photo of the AWM WOT. The restorer was Alec Duke from Murtleford. You are correct. It was an exCFA truck. Alec helped me out with patterns for the hood and fuel tank shields on my truck. After I gave a couple of parts to the Bandiana Museum WOT, I loaned them the tank shield and they got the Tennix(?) workshops to knock up a set for both of us. It would be interesting to know how WOTs remain. I can account for about a dozen. I have had four.
